Found in a pleasing and prominent position within the centre of the village, the property is within a short stroll of facilities and surrounded by similar attractive period properties. The village of Rickinghall adjoins Botesdale and has proved to be a desirable location over the years, with a lovely assortment of many period and modern properties yet still retaining an excellent range of amenities and facilities including a health centre, supermarket, public house, schooling, church and transport links. The nearby market town of Diss is found just 7 miles to the east which provides a more extensive range of day-to-day amenities and facilities along with the benefit of a mainline railway station with regular/direct services to London Liverpool Street and Norwich.
